As US slumps, Chrysler looks abroad Avenger's debut in Paris showscases Dodge's export push
As Chrysler group's sales in the US fall, the brand is looking to Europe for a boost. The group's muscle brand -- Dodge -- is leading the push to boost sales outside North America. story

2006 Paris Motor Show, Paris Expo, Porte de Versailles in Paris
Show Dates: Sept. 28-29 (press days); Sept. 30 - Oct. 15;
Public hours: 10 a.m.-10 p.m. on Tuesdays, Wednesdays, Thursdays and Fridays; 10 a.m. - 8 p.m. on Saturdays, Sundays and Mondays.
Tickets: 12 EUR, free for children under 10. More show information is available at www.mondial-automobile.com.
